- This invention relates to work-feeding devices for sewing machines and more particularly to a convertible workfeeding device for a sewing machine which is capable of both straight-stitch and zigzag-stitch sewing.
- zigzaz sewing machines it is highly desirable to include a provision for straight-stitch sewing in order to enchance the versatility of the machines.
- straightstitch sewing may constitute the sewing operation most frequently performed.
- a feed dog which has at least two rows of teeth to grip the work on each side of the seam.
- the optimum lateral distance between the rows of teeth is different for straight-stitch sewing and for zigzag-stitch sewing.
- Another object of the invention is to provide a convertible work-feeding device for a sewing machine, the work-feeding device being convertible to approach 0ptimum work-feeding conditions in both straight-stitch and zigzag-stitch sewing.
- the main feature of the invention is the provision of means to adjust the lateral spacing between seam-straddling rows of teeth in a work-feeding device for a sewing machine.
- the teeth are placed in sufficient open position to furnish clearance for the zigzag needle penetrations while in straight-stitch sewing, the teeth are placed in close position for uniform and wrinkle-free work feeding.
- the means for adjusting the lateral distance between the teeth include an elongated auxiliary feed bar carrying one of the rows of teeth which in effect constitute an auxiliary feed dog, while the other teeth constitute a main feed dog.
- An auxiliary feed bar is pivotally mounted on a concentric portion of an eccentric stud rotation of which permits adjustment of the height of the teeth of the auxiliary feed dog relatively to the height of the teeth of the main feed dog.
- the length of the elongated auxiliary feed bar between the pivot stud and the top of the auxiliary feed dog and the small lateral displacement involved makes the slight tilt of the auxiliary feed dog minimal when in either open or close position.

- the work-feeding device of the invention is illustrated as incorporated in a conventional sewing machine having a frame which includes a work-supporting bed 10 and a sewing head 11.
- a frame which includes a work-supporting bed 10 and a sewing head 11.
- Mounted in the sewing head is an endwise-reciprocating needle bar 12 to which is clamped by means of a clamping screw 13 a thread-carrying needle 14.
- the thread-carrying needle is adapted to cooperate with a complementary stitch-forming mechanism represented by a loop taker 15 mounted inside the work-supporting bed.
- a presser bar 16 the relevance of which will be explained later.
- the workfeeding mechanism includes a feed-advance rock shaft 17 mounted between two pintles 18 of which only one is shown. Pivotally supported between a pair of rock arms 19 upstanding from the feed-advance rock shaft 17 is a feed bar 20 to which the rock arms impart feed advance and return motion in response to oscillation of the rock shaft 17.
- the feed bar 20 has a depending portion 21 at its distal end and by means of screws 22 mounts two rows of feed teeth 23 and 24 which in effect constitute a main feed dog 25. Therefore, hereinafter, the feed bar 20 will be referred to as the main feed bar.
- auxiliary feed bar mounting means or bracket 26 which may be connected to the depending portion 21 as by brazing 27.
- auxiliary feed bar mounting bracket 26 To the auxiliary feed bar mounting bracket 26, there is pivotally connected an elongated auxiliary feed bar 28.
- the pivotal means for mounting the auxiliary feed bar 28 includes a pivot stud 29 which has a concentric portion 30.
- a setscrew 31 in the bracket 26 and bearing against an eccentric portion 32 of the pivot stud 29 maintains the eccentric portion 32 of the stud against rotation and in a preset orientation whereby to provide for adjustment of the height of the auxiliary feed bar 28.
- a stop means or bracket 35 secured to the front of the depending portion 21 of the main feed bar 20 by means of screws 36 limits the extent of swinging lateral movement of the auxiiliary feed dog 34.
- a feed-1ift connecting lever 39 Pivotally connected to the depending portion 21 of the main feed bar 20 by means of a pivot screw 38 is a feed-1ift connecting lever 39 which serves to impart feed-lift motion to the main feed bar 20 in synchronism with the feed advance and return motion imparted by the feedadvance rock shaft 17. Since the convertible work-feeding device of this invention may be used with any conventional driving means for the feed-advance and feed-lift mechanism, only the feed-advance rock shaft 17 and the feed-lift connecting lever 39 are disclosed. herein.
- the teeth 23, 24 and 33 of the feed dogs 25 and 34 are placed in open position as shown in FIGS. 1 and 2 to provide clearance for the zigzag movements of the reciprocating needle 14 which penetrates between the endmost rows of feed teeth 23 and 33.
- the teeth of the feed dogs rise above correspondingly positioned slots 40 in a throat plate 41 to cooperate with a soleplate 42 of a presser device or foot 43 to feed work to be sewn which is placed on the work-supporting bed 10.
- the throat plate 41 is removably mounted on the worksupporting bed by means of two downwardly springbiased posts 44, while the presser foot 43 is removably clamped to the presser bar 16' by means of a clamping screw 45.
- Both the throat plate 41 and the presser foot 43 contain laterally elongated needle-clearance slots or apertures 46 and 47 respectively, to accommodate the lateral penetrations of the needle.
- the throat plate 41 is removed from the work-supporting bed 10 and, as shown in FIGS. 4 and 5, the teeth 23, 24,
- a second throat plate 48 having slots 49 corresponding to the teeth of the feed dogs in close position is substituted for the throat plate 41 because the slots 40 of the throat plate 41 no longer line up with the teeth of the feed dogs.
- the presser foot 43 may be replaced in favor of a presser foot t) having a narrower sole-plate 51 corresponding to the teeth of the feed dogs in close position.
- the stop bracket 35 limits the maximum open and minimum close positions of the auxiliary feed dog 34. However, it is the slots 40 or 4-9 in the throat plate 41 or 48 which maintain the feed teeth 23, 24 and 33 in open or close position depending on which throat plate 41 or 48 is secured to the work-supporting bed of the sewing machine. Since the feed-lift movement imparted to the feed bar by the conventional feed-lift mechanism is such that the teeth of the feed dogs and 34 never drop below the bottom 52 or 53 of the throat plate, the throat plate slots or 49 will act as guides for the rows of feed dog teeth to maintain the selected spacing therebetween.
- the eccentric portion 32 of the pivot stud 38 permits adjustment of the height of the teeth of the auxiliary feed dog relative to the height of the teeth of the main feed dog while the length of the elongated auxiliary feed bar 28 from the pivot stud 29 to the top of the auxiliary feed dog 34 and the slight lateral displacement involved maintains the top of the teeth 33 of the auxiliary fed dog 34 substantially in a plane coincident with a plane determined by the top of the teeth 23 and 24 of the main feed dog 25 whether the auxiliary feed dog 34 is in open position for zigzag-stitch sew-ing or in close position for straight-stitch sewing.
